Before 1952 Season: Signed by the St. Louis Browns as an amateur free agent.
June, 1957: Sent from the Baltimore Orioles to the Chicago Cubs in an unknown transaction. (Date given is approximate. Exact date is uncertain.)
Before 1958 Season: Sent from the Chicago Cubs to the Philadelphia Phillies in an unknown transaction.
July, 1958: Traded by the Philadelphia Phillies to the Chicago White Sox for Bobby Winkles.
June 15, 1960: Purchased by Indianapolis (American Association) from the Chicago White Sox.
September 14, 1961: Purchased by the Minnesota Twins from Indianapolis (American Association).
